Cost Considerations
When evaluating the economic aspect of buying versus renting out building and construction tools, the ahead of time prices and long-term expenses must be very carefully considered. Leasing tools frequently requires lower initial payments contrasted to purchasing, making it an eye-catching alternative for short-term jobs or professionals with spending plan restrictions. Leasing removes the need for big capital expenses and reduces the monetary threat connected with devices ownership, such as upkeep and depreciation expenses. Nevertheless, over time, continually renting out tools can build up higher expenses than buying, especially for extended jobs.
On the various other hand, buying building devices includes higher upfront expenses but can result in long-term financial savings, specifically for long-term projects or frequent users. Having tools provides adaptability, ease, and the possibility for resale worth once the task is finished. Additionally, having devices permits personalization and knowledge with certain equipment, potentially increasing efficiency and productivity on-site. Eventually, the choice in between buying and leasing building devices rests on the job's duration, frequency of use, budget plan factors to consider, and lasting monetary objectives.

Danger Management
Efficient risk administration in building equipment operations is paramount to making sure task success and mitigating prospective monetary losses. Building and construction tasks inherently involve numerous risks, such as tools failures, crashes, and project delays, which can dramatically influence the project timeline and budget plan. By meticulously considering the threats related to owning or renting building and construction devices, project supervisors can make enlightened decisions to reduce these potential dangers.
Renting construction devices can supply a degree of threat mitigation by moving the responsibility of maintenance and repair services to the rental business. This can lower the financial problem on the project proprietor in situation of unforeseen devices failings (dozer rental). Additionally, leasing gives the adaptability to gain access to specific tools for certain job stages, minimizing the danger of owning underutilized machinery
On the various other hand, having construction tools gives a sense of control over its usage and upkeep. Nonetheless, this likewise suggests bearing the complete duty for fixings, upkeep prices, and depreciation, increasing the economic dangers connected with equipment ownership.
